diff --git a/import-layers/yocto-poky/meta/classes/fs-uuid.bbclass b/import-layers/yocto-poky/meta/classes/fs-uuid.bbclass new file mode 100644 index 000000000..bd2613cf1 --- /dev/null +++ b/import-layers/yocto-poky/meta/classes/fs-uuid.bbclass @@ -0,0 +1,24 @@ +# Extract UUID from ${ROOTFS}, which must have been built +# by the time that this function gets called. Only works +# on ext file systems and depends on tune2fs. +def get_rootfs_uuid(d): + import subprocess + rootfs = d.getVar('ROOTFS', True) + output = subprocess.check_output(['tune2fs', '-l', rootfs]) + for line in output.split('\n'): + if line.startswith('Filesystem UUID:'): + uuid = line.split()[-1] + bb.note('UUID of %s: %s' % (rootfs, uuid)) + return uuid + bb.fatal('Could not determine filesystem UUID of %s' % rootfs) + +# Replace the special <<uuid-of-rootfs>> inside a string (like the +# root= APPEND string in a syslinux.cfg or gummiboot entry) with the +# actual UUID of the rootfs. Does nothing if the special string +# is not used. +def replace_rootfs_uuid(d, string): + UUID_PLACEHOLDER = '<<uuid-of-rootfs>>' + if UUID_PLACEHOLDER in string: + uuid = get_rootfs_uuid(d) + string = string.replace(UUID_PLACEHOLDER, uuid) + return string |
